Opsonization of normal myelin by anti-myelin antibodies and normal serum.

Abstract

Fc receptor-dependent myelin phagocytosis has been proposed as a possible important effector mechanism in several immune-mediated demyelinating diseases. The present study was designed to determine whether myelin is opsonizable by anti-myelin antibodies. Thioglycolate-elicited mouse peritoneal macrophages were cultured with 125I-labelled bovine central myelin pretreated with normal or immune serum. Serum opsonic activity was determined by a kinetic study comparing macrophage uptake of opsonized and untreated 125I-myelin. Heat-stable and heat-labile myelin opsonins were detected in normal rabbit serum. Myelin was also opsonized by normal rabbit gamma globulin and by heat-inactivated normal mouse, human, and guinea pig serum. Increased opsonic activity was detected in rabbit anti-myelin antiserum and the gamma globulin fraction prepared from this serum, in anti-myelin basic protein and anti-galactocerebroside antiserum but not in anti-myelin-associated glycoprotein antiserum or in serum from rabbits injected with Freund's adjuvant alone. One out of three anti-sheep red blood cell antisera tested also showed increased myelin opsonic activity. It is concluded that anti-myelin antibodies can promote opsonic phagocytosis, and that normal serum and normal serum gamma globulin also opsonize myelin.

摘要

Fc受体依赖性髓鞘吞噬作用被认为是几种免疫介导的脱髓鞘疾病中一种可能的重要效应机制。本研究旨在确定髓鞘是否可被抗髓鞘抗体调理。用正常或免疫血清预处理的125I标记的牛中枢髓鞘培养巯基乙酸盐诱导的小鼠腹腔巨噬细胞。通过动力学研究比较巨噬细胞对调理过的和未处理的125I-髓鞘的摄取来确定血清调理活性。在正常兔血清中检测到热稳定和热不稳定的髓鞘调理素。髓鞘也被正常兔γ球蛋白以及热灭活的正常小鼠、人及豚鼠血清调理。在兔抗髓鞘抗血清和由此血清制备的γ球蛋白组分、抗髓鞘碱性蛋白和抗半乳糖脑苷脂抗血清中检测到调理活性增加,但在抗髓鞘相关糖蛋白抗血清或仅注射弗氏佐剂的兔血清中未检测到。所测试的三种抗绵羊红细胞抗血清中的一种也显示出髓鞘调理活性增加。结论是抗髓鞘抗体可促进调理吞噬作用,并且正常血清和正常血清γ球蛋白也可调理髓鞘。
